In Australia, the labelling of cosmetic products is governed by the Australian Consumer Law (ACL) as well as the Cosmetic Standard set forth by the National Industrial Chemicals Notification and Assessment Scheme (NICNAS). These regulations ensure that all cosmetics are safe for consumer use and that they do not contain prohibited substances. Labels must provide essential information such as the product name, ingredient list, and any necessary warnings or usage instructions. Clarity and accuracy are paramount to avoiding misleading claims about product efficacy and safety.
Manufacturers and importers must also adhere to specific guidelines when it comes to claims made on packaging. This includes ensuring that the term "natural" is substantiated and not misleading to consumers. Additionally, the labelling must comply with both the Australian Competition and Consumer Commission (ACCC) requirements for consumer protection and the Unique Identifier requirements for therapeutic goods, should any claims suggest a therapeutic benefit. These standards are designed to uphold consumer trust and promote informed purchasing decisions within the cosmetics market.
